From 610ae05f9127b8c73e86f20dbff9ca0cd7e019e8 Mon Sep 17 00:00:00 2001 From: Takashi Kajinami Date: Mon, 21 Nov 2022 17:50:50 +0900 Subject: [PATCH] Remove logic for CentOS < 9 ... because RDO supports CentOS Stream 9 (aka CentOS 9) only since Zed. Change-Id: I0ff6eb5da73d1be6fd8e5f1c8127f9b18116c7b9 --- manifests/params.pp | 9 ++------- spec/classes/nova_compute_spec.rb | 19 +++---------------- 2 files changed, 5 insertions(+), 23 deletions(-) diff --git a/manifests/params.pp b/manifests/params.pp index 40756f3a3..57fd6758a 100644 --- a/manifests/params.pp +++ b/manifests/params.pp @@ -59,13 +59,8 @@ class nova::params { $nova_api_wsgi_script_source = '/usr/bin/nova-api-wsgi' $nova_metadata_wsgi_script_source = '/usr/bin/nova-metadata-wsgi' $messagebus_service_name = 'dbus' - if versioncmp($::operatingsystemmajrelease, '9') >= 0 { - $mkisofs_package_name = 'xorriso' - $mkisofs_cmd = 'mkisofs' - } else { - $mkisofs_package_name = 'genisoimage' - $mkisofs_cmd = false - } + $mkisofs_package_name = 'xorriso' + $mkisofs_cmd = 'mkisofs' } 'Debian': { # package names diff --git a/spec/classes/nova_compute_spec.rb b/spec/classes/nova_compute_spec.rb index a5418c89e..c740e07d6 100644 --- a/spec/classes/nova_compute_spec.rb +++ b/spec/classes/nova_compute_spec.rb @@ -369,24 +369,11 @@ describe 'nova::compute' do let (:platform_params) do { :nova_compute_package => 'openstack-nova-compute', - :nova_compute_service => 'openstack-nova-compute' + :nova_compute_service => 'openstack-nova-compute', + :mkisofs_package => 'xorriso', + :mkisofs_cmd => 'mkisofs' } end - if facts[:operatingsystemmajrelease].to_i >= 9 - before do - platform_params.merge!({ - :mkisofs_package => 'xorriso', - :mkisofs_cmd => 'mkisofs' - }) - end - else - before do - platform_params.merge!({ - :mkisofs_package => 'genisoimage', - :mkisofs_cmd => '' - }) - end - end end it_behaves_like 'nova-compute' end